The Importance of Wine Storage
Protecting Your Investment
Temperature and Humidity Control
When it comes to preserving the quality of your wine, temperature and humidity control are crucial. A sideboard with wine storage can provide the perfect environment for your bottles. By maintaining a consistent temperature between 45°F and 65°F (7°C and 18°C) and a relative humidity of 50-70%, you can slow down the aging process and prevent spoilage.

The Importance of Wine Storage for Wine Connoisseurs
For those who appreciate fine wine, storing bottles properly is crucial to preserve their quality and flavor. Exposure to direct sunlight, temperature fluctuations, and vibrations can all harm the delicate characteristics of wine. This is where a well-designed sideboard with wine storage comes into play, offering a space-saving solution to keep wine collections safe and within easy reach.
